John Paul Pet Tooth & Gum Pet Wipes are specially formulated to maintain your pet's dental hygiene while ensuring their breath stays fresh. Each container includes 45 wipes infused with peppermint oil and baking soda, designed to safely clean plaque and prevent gum disease. Proudly made in the USA, these wipes are cruelty-free and paraben-free, making them a responsible choice for pet owners.
